NAMM '09- D-CAM Synthsquad:the squad with a lot of mod

From fxpansion comes the very kickass D-CAM Synth Squad suite, consisting of three synths, done up with component-level modeling, i.e. they went to great lengths to model all the parts of original instruments for super-realistic analog behavior. Ya get all three synths in the package: Strobe: quick and easy monosynth... Roland SH-101-like in character. Cypher: big, bad ass polysynth capable of wicked audio-rate mod (not easy to get right in virtual world)... the first plug capable of thru-zero modulation for you modular synth nerds in the crowd. Zeroscillator, anyone? Amber: modeled divide-down string synth in the vein of ARP String Ensemble/Solina, et al. This might be the first modeled divide-down style synth too. Hmmm. Fusor: this module lets you combine and modulate all three as one plug, not unlike the Korg virtual Wavestation/Polysix/MS-20 dealie. Shipping second quarter, should be $299 street price for the whole shebuegla.
